It's no secret that erectile dysfunction (ED) is a prevalent issue affecting millions of men worldwide. While there are various medical treatments available, many individuals are seeking more natural, non-pharmacological approaches to address this sensitive and often complex condition. That's where the potential benefits of practices like yoga and meditation come into play.

A growing body of scientific evidence suggests that these mind-body techniques can have a positive impact on sexual function. A study published in the Journal of Sexual Medicine found that a regular yoga practice was associated with improved sexual desire, arousal, and satisfaction in men. The researchers attribute this to yoga's ability to reduce stress, enhance body awareness, and promote better blood flow – all of which are crucial factors in maintaining healthy erectile function.

Similarly, research has demonstrated the efficacy of meditation in addressing ED. A 2013 study published in the Journal of Sexual Medicine observed that men who engaged in a mindfulness-based intervention experienced significant improvements in their erectile function, sexual desire, and overall sexual satisfaction. The authors suggest that meditation's capacity to alleviate performance anxiety, enhance focus, and regulate physiological arousal may be the driving factors behind these benefits.

Of course, it's important to note that erectile dysfunction can have various underlying causes, from physical to psychological, and a comprehensive healthcare approach is always recommended. But the growing evidence and personal accounts suggest that incorporating mind-body techniques into one's overall wellness routine may be a valuable addition to the arsenal of ED management strategies.
